About The Position

The Director of Operations is the architect of the daily guest experience with a strong focus on lifestyle hospitality, Food & Beverage excellence, and curated guest. This role provides strategic leadership across all departments, with a heavy emphasis on integrating Food & Beverage excellence into the broader hotel operation. The Director of Operations is responsible for driving profitability through sophisticated revenue growth, rigorous cost management, and the mentorship of department heads.

Requirements

  • 5+ years of senior leadership in a high-volume hotel environment (must include Rooms and F&B experience).
  • Expert-level knowledge of Property Management Systems (PMS) and F&B Point of Sale (POS) systems.
  • Strong analytical skills regarding P&L and labor reports.
  • A hands-on leader who thrives in a fast-paced environment and possesses exceptional conflict-resolution skills for both guests and employees.
  • Ability to remain standing/walking for extended periods and move through all areas of the property (front and back of house).
  • Flexibility to work variable schedules, including evenings, weekends, and holidays.
  • Degree in Hospitality Management or equivalent work experience required.

Responsibilities

  • Direct the operational success of the restaurant, bar, and lounge, ensuring that service standards reflect the Hotel Nyack brand.
  • Oversee banquet and event operations, partnering closely with Sales and culinary leadership to ensure flawless execution of weddings, corporate meetings, social events, and group programming while maximizing guest satisfaction and event profitability.
  • Monitor banquet labor, beverage costs, service standards, and event flow to ensure operational efficiency and a high-quality guest experience across all group and catering business.
  • Collaborate with the Executive Chef to monitor Food & Beverage COGS (Cost of Goods Sold), analyze menu engineering for profitability, and manage beverage inventory.
  • Ensure 100% compliance with Department of Health regulations, NYS liquor laws (including TIPS/RAMP training), and workplace safety standards.
  • Maintain a high-profile presence on the floor during peak meal periods and events to conduct "table touches," drive guest satisfaction, and mentor service staff.
  • Oversee Front Office and Housekeeping to ensure guest arrival/departure experiences are flawless and room cleanliness scores exceed brand standards.
  • Coordinate with the Chief Engineer to manage the property's preventative maintenance plan, energy efficiency, and capital improvement projects.
  • Lead negotiations and manage relationships with third-party contractors and service providers to ensure the hotel receives maximum value and service quality.
  • Serve as the primary lead for property emergency procedures, risk management, and the safety of all guests and associates.
  • Lead daily operational stand-ups and ensure alignment between Rooms, F&B, Events, and Engineering to deliver a seamless guest experience and strong operational flow.
  • Full accountability for the property's operating budget, including labor management and expense control across all departments.
  • Assist the General Manager in monthly financial forecasting and the development of the annual operating budget.
  • Implement and monitor departmental "checkbooks" to ensure all managers are spending within their allocated monthly budgets.
  • Recruit, train, and retain top-tier talent.
  • Facilitate regular one-on-one development meetings with department heads.
  • Drive a culture of accountability through clear goal setting, regular performance reviews, and active coaching.
  • Oversee departmental scheduling to ensure staffing levels are optimized based on occupancy and F&B covers.
